When a ROM is "clean," it contains all original data exactly as it exists on a legitimate game cartridge, including both standard DS and Dsi binaries where applicable.
The "DSi binaries are missing" error occurs when detects that a game's ROM lacks the specific code required for DSi-enhanced features, such as cameras and improved Wi-Fi . This is common with Gen 5 Pokémon games (Black, White, Black 2, White 2). Why this happens
Whether you're using an emulator, flashcart, or CFW, updates frequently improve DSi binary compatibility.
DeSmuME has limited DSi support compared to MelonDS, but if you use it: Go to > Emulation Settings . When a ROM is "clean," it contains all
But if the game is (not just enhanced), you must get a clean ROM and proper DSi BIOS files.
When you try to load that incomplete ROM on a DSi, 3DS, or a modern emulator (like DeSmuME or MelonDS) running in DSi mode, the software checks the header. It sees: “This game claims to have DSi binaries. Let me look for them… Not found.” Then it throws the error.
Many emulators are set to boot in "DSi Mode" by default or automatically switch to it when they detect certain games. If a game has minor DSi-enhanced features (like Pokemon Black or White), the emulator might try to boot it as a full DSi game. If you haven't set up the DSi binaries, the boot sequence fails. 3. Bad or Corrupted ROM Dumps Why this happens Whether you're using an emulator,
: Files downloaded from certain sources might be stripped of DSi data to save space. How to resolve it Run in DS Mode : If you press
DSi binaries are specific parts of a game's code that allow it to use DSi hardware features, such as the , improved Wi-Fi (WPA2 support), and a slightly faster CPU speed.
The legal and safest method to acquire these files is to hardware-modify (homebrew) a physical Nintendo DSi console and use a tool like to copy your own console's BIOS, Firmware, and NAND to an SD card. Once you have the files on your computer: Open your emulator (e.g., melonDS). When you try to load that incomplete ROM
If you own physical DS/DSi games:
The error message "the dsi binaries are missing please obtain a clean rom better" typically occurs when using TWiLight Menu++ to play "DSi-enhanced" games (like Pokémon Black/White Black 2/White 2 ). It means
Let’s clear up the confusion you might see on forums.